How they compare

Republic of Moldova currently reports 49.8% against 49.8% in Montenegro, a difference of 0.0%.

The two have swapped places 4 times across 14 shared years of data; in 2003 it was Republic of Moldova ahead.

Republic of Moldova ranks 99th and Montenegro ranks 102nd of 204 countries.

Across the 2 decades both report, Republic of Moldova averaged higher in 1 and Montenegro in 1.
